Here is a quick summary of how we cause climate change. Human generated emission of carbon dioxide and other greenhouse gases have caused increasing concentrations of these gases in the atmosphere. The increases are measurable and indisputably human caused. The concentration increases have been shown to drive observed increases in worldwide average temperature. Sophisticated mathematical models evaluated by the UN’s Intergovernmental Panel on Climate Change (IPCC) forecast a continuing increase of 0.1 to 0.3 degrees Celsius per decade (95% confidence) in the near future. Even a modestly competent engineer like me can build a much cruder model that yields a result in this range (mine says 0.17 degrees Celsius per decade).

The consequences of this rate of increase include sea level rise on the order of four or five feet in the next century, expansion of desert areas, and a dramatic undesirable shift in agricultural productivity.
